Nothing's Changed

Album: Camino Palmero (2001)
Play Video

Songfacts®:

  • Written by lead singer Alex Band and guitarist Aaron Kamin, Band says, "It's a song about parents not understanding you and it doesn't matter how many years go by or how close you are to them, they will never understand." Band has talked about being neglected by his parents while he was growing up and how he can't go to them for help even after all these years because nothing's changed at all. >>>
